Car industry companies slowly recognize that some smart screens are stupid. Last month, President Volkswagen Design Andreas Mindt said that the next generation of the German auto industry will get material buttons for heating, heating seats, fan lights, and risk lights. This shift will be applied “in every car we make from now on”, ” Mint said British car magazine Autocar.
In recognition of Snafus touch by his predecessors – in 2019, Wooked VW MK8 golf is an axiom to work and “progressive” when it was not the case – Mindt said, “We will not make this error anymore … it’s not a phone, it’s a car.”

The latest version of Mazda’s CX-60 Crossover Suv It features a 12.3 -inch screen, and there is still a physical adoption key to operate the heater, air, and paid/refrigerated seats. Although it is still sensitive to touch, the Mazda screen limits what you can urge depending on the application you use and whether you are in a movement. There is also a real click wheel.

Ninety -seven percent of the new cars that were released after 2023 contains at least one screen, It is believed that S&P Global Mobility. After the search last year by Britain Which car? The magazine found that the vast majority of car drivers prefer faces and switching to touch screens. A survey of 1,428 drivers found that 89 percent prefer physical buttons.
